es·o·ter·i·ca
(ĕs′ə-tĕr′ĭ-kə)pl.n. (used with a sing. or pl. verb)
Esoteric matters or items.
[Greek esōterika, from neuter pl. of esōterikos, esoteric; see esoteric.]

es•o•ter•i•ca
(ˌɛs əˈtɛr ɪ kə)n.pl.
esoteric facts or matters.
[1925–30; < New Latin, n. use of neuter pl. of Greek esōterikós esoteric]
